The 'retention rate' of paying subscribers is what's keeping it going as a business. The reason it works: I set out to do something simple & stuck to it. Make it easier to find the news (serving readers) + send eyeballs to local journalism (serving publishers) while 100% ad-free. Thanks readers!
edinburghminute.bsky.social
I don’t say this enough but I’m so grateful to all the readers & subscribers of the Edinburgh Minute. You make the newsletter so much better. I don’t strive for millions of readers. That’s the antithesis of local news IMO. Open-rate among 25k ppl remains over 60% after 700+ editions. Loyalty! 🙏
